318

A buddy of mine has an older dodge pickup with the 318. He wants to just change the lifters and push rods, because he figures they have a lot of wear. He isn't going to change the cam though, and although he is expecting more wear on the lifters because of this, he was wondering if he could still change the rods and lifters? He doesn't want to have to pull the engine, so any help give is appreciated!Thanks.

yeah you can change only the lifters and pushrods but i did the same thing and within 2 months two of the lifters had wore holes in the bottom of them and it was backfiring like hell i would recommend changing the cam also
